The game play of on the web roulette stays faithful to its old-fashioned equivalent, featuring a spinning wheel and a betting table. People destination their particular wagers on various numbers, colors, or combinations, and wait for wheel to avoid spinning. The winning bets are determined by the positioning in which the ball places on wheel.

class=Benefits of On The Web Roulette:

1. efficiency: one of the primary benefits of online roulette may be the convenience it provides. Players will enjoy the game from the absolute comfort of their homes or on-the-go through numerous gambling on line systems, removing the need to go to land-based gambling enterprises.

2. Accessibility: Online roulette provides easy access towards the online game at any time, no matter geographical location. This starts up options for players residing in nations in which standard gambling is restricted or illegal.

3. Game Variations: on the web roulette provides many online game variants, offering people with numerous options to fit their choices. These variations may include US, European, or French roulette, each with slight differences in principles and wagering options.

Drawbacks of On The Web Roulette:

1. decreased Social communication: While online roulette provides convenience, it lacks the social interaction present in land-based gambling enterprises. The lack of a physical environment and discussion with other people can detract from general betting experience for many individuals.

2. chance of Addiction: Online gambling presents the possibility of addiction, and online roulette is not any exclusion. The ease of access, with the fast-paced nature associated with game, could induce excessive gambling behavior and financial hardships.
